1. Bosch SMS6IKW01I
For a kitchen that runs a dishwasher every single day, this model earns its keep. With a 14-place setting capacity and an intensive Kadhai program designed specifically for oily Indian cookware, it tackles tough stains. The Home Connect feature lets you check or start a load from your phone. Perfect for daily use.
2. IFB Neptune FX14
The 70°C DeepClean wash pairs with hygienic steam drying. A built-in water softener gives a real advantage in cities with hard tap water, preventing residue on glassware. At 12 liters per cycle, it handles a full day’s dishes for larger households in one load.
3. LG DFB424FP
Noise is often a concern with dishwashers, and this LG model answers it well. Four spray arms replace the usual two, and an inverter direct-drive motor eliminates belts and pulleys, cutting sound noticeably. Smart Diagnosis through the LG ThinQ app helps pinpoint faults, making service visits more efficient.
4. Faber FFSD 6PR 12S
Built for first-time buyers who want simplicity, this unit offers 12 place settings, six wash programs, and a half-load option for smaller daily loads. Water use stays around 11 liters per cycle—among the lowest here. A 2-year comprehensive warranty with 5-year rust cover adds peace of mind.
5. Midea MDWPF1301F(B)
The lowest price on this list doesn’t mean fewest features. It includes 13 place settings, 7 wash programs, a dedicated glass care mode, and WiFi control through the Midea SmartHome app—typically found only on pricier machines. A self-cleaning function reduces manual filter maintenance.
How to Maximize Your Savings
Listed prices are rarely final. Checking a few things at checkout can save another ₹1,000 to ₹4,000 on top of the sale price. Bank card tie-ins change between sale events, so confirm the current offer rather than assuming last month’s deal still applies. Amazon and Flipkart often price the same model differently during overlapping sales—compare both platforms. No-cost EMI terms vary by card and tenure; weigh it against paying upfront. Exchange bonuses for old appliances are often hidden until checkout. Installation charges (₹500–₹1,500) are usually separate.
